UK imported no fuels from Russia in June while import of goods also dropped to £33m amid Ukraine war
Sky News ^ | 24-AUG-2022 | Sky News

Posted on 08/24/2022 11:17:08 AM PDT by SpeedyInTexas

Britain imported no fuels from Russia in June for the first time on record following the imposition of sanctions over the invasion of Ukraine, official data shows.

The figure published by the Office for National Statistics (ONS) comes after the UK moved to sever all reliance on Moscow for its power needs in the face of Kremlin aggression by phasing out the use of its oil and gas.
